9 1/2000 scale zoning plan projects in Thu Duc city
On June 23, the People's Committee of Thu Duc City announced 9 1/2000 scale zoning plan projects and awarded decisions approving investment policies and adjusting investment policies for projects in the area.
Sub-zone 1 is located in Thu Thiem ward, An Loi Dong, Thao Dien, part of An Khanh ward, An Phu ward with an area of 1,807 hectares, population of 332,500 people, the main development orientation is the international financial center of Thu Thiem.
Sub-zone 2 belongs to Hiep Binh Chanh ward and part of Linh Dong, Truong Tho, Hiep Binh Phuoc, Tam Phu, Tam Binh wards with an area of 2,042 hectares, population of 270,000 people, with the main development orientation of Truong Tho new urban center.
Sub-zone 3 belongs to Linh Tay, Linh Chieu, Binh Tho, Linh Trung, Binh Chieu, Linh Xuan wards and part of Tam Binh, Tam Phu, Linh Dong, Truong Tho, Hiep Binh Phuoc wards with an area of 2,468 hectares, population of 440,000 people, with the main orientation of developing Ho Chi Minh City National University.
Sub-zone 4 belongs to Long Binh ward and part of Tan Phu ward, Long Thanh My ward with an area of 2,945 hectares, population of 280,442 people, with the main orientation being the National Historical - Cultural Park towards public parks, theme parks combined with eco-tourism.
Sub-zone 5 belongs to Long Phuoc ward and part of Truong Thanh ward, Long Truong ward with an area of 3,425 hectares, population of 210,000 people, with the main orientation of developing a knowledge urban area with the core being institutes - schools, specialized research and training facilities in Long Phuoc area.
Sub-zone 6 is part of Thanh My Loi, Cat Lai, Binh Trung Dong, Phu Huu wards with an area of 1,587 hectares, a population of 127,500 people, with the main orientation of being the port, industrial and logistics service center of Ho Chi Minh City and neighboring urban areas.
Sub-zone 7 belongs to Binh Trung Tay ward and part of An Khanh, An Phu, Phu Huu, Binh Trung Dong, Cat Lai, Phuoc Long B, Thanh My Loi wards with an area of 1,748 hectares, population of 300,000 people, with the main orientation of developing a multi-functional mixed-use urban area along the Ho Chi Minh City - Long Thanh - Dau Giay expressway and Vo Chi Cong street.
Sub-zone 8 belongs to Phuoc Long A, Phuoc Long B, Phuoc Binh wards and part of An Phu, Tang Nhon Phu B, Phu Huu wards with an area of 1,195 hectares, a population of 248,000 people, with the main development orientation being Rach Chiec National Sports Complex combining the function of urban public parks and service functions, becoming one of the development driving forces of the city.
Sub-zone 9 belongs to Hiep Phu ward, Tang Nhon Phu A ward, Tang Nhon Phu B ward and part of Phuoc Long B ward, Tan Phu ward, Long Thanh My ward, Truong Thanh ward, Long Truong ward, Phu Huu ward with an area of 2,222 hectares, population of 345,000 people, with the main development orientation being to renovate and encourage the reconstruction of existing residential areas, forming multi-functional complexes along main traffic axes associated with public transport such as Vo Nguyen Giap - Hanoi Highway, Ring Road 2, Ring Road 3, Ho Chi Minh City - Long Thanh - Dau Giay Expressway.
Orientation for new development when implementing the two-level government model
Mr. Hoang Tung - Chairman of Thu Duc City People's Committee - said that the projects not only clearly define the development space of functional areas and 11 strategic development focuses in Thu Duc City, but also serve as a legal basis to attract investment, develop synchronous infrastructure, and improve the quality of life for people.
This is also an important legal basis for orienting development in the new period when implementing the 2-level government model, and a guideline for orienting the development of development space for the fields of services, training, finance, high technology, logistics, seaports and innovation associated with the Southeast region, focusing on the international financial center of Thu Thiem.
It is known that in the coming time, Thu Duc City will become 12 wards in coordination with relevant departments and units to urgently establish and cover detailed projects 1/500. This will be an important basis in construction management, urban development management and moving towards exempting construction permits for individual houses.
The goal is to have the detailed planning of 1/500 approved in Thu Duc City and a pilot exemption of construction permits for individual houses from January 1, 2026 by the end of 2025.
